JS实现数组去重的六种方式

1.ES6 set去重

function uniq(arr){
  var a=new Set(arr);
  var b=[...a];
    return b
}

var aa = [1,2,1,4,3,3,2,4,6,7,7,7,7,7,7,7,7];
console.log(uniq(aa));

2.indexOf去重

function uniq(arr){
    var temp = []; //一个新的临时数组
    for(var i = 0; i < array.length; i++){
        if(temp.indexOf(arr[i]) == -1){   //建议用includes(ES6)
            temp.push(arr[i]);
        }
    }
    return temp;
}

var aa = [1,2,2,4,9];
console.log(uniq(aa));

3.利用对象做第二个容器(有点像方法2)

function uniq(arr){
    var res = [];
    var obj = {};
    for(var i=0; i<arr.length; i++){
        if (!obj[arr[i]]) {
            obj[arr[i]] = 1;
            res.push(arr[i])
        }
    }
    return res;
}

4.利用对象键不重复的特性(有点绕)

function uniq(arr){
    var res = [];
    var obj = {};
    for(var i=0; i<arr.length; i++){
            obj[arr[i]] = 1;
    }
    for(var j in obj){
        if(isNaN(j)==false){
            var a = Number(j);
            res.push(a)
        }
        else{
            res.push(j)
        }
    }
    return res;
}
var aa = [1,2,1,4,3,3,2,4,6,7,7,7,7,7,7,7,7,"a","a","a"];
console.log(uniq(aa));

5.先排序后判断后面一个和前面一个相等不

function uniq(arr){
  arr.sort();
  for(var i= 0;i <arr.length;i++){
      if(arr[i]==arr[i-1]){
          arr.splice(i,1);
          i--;//splice以后数组会改变减少一个i也要减少
      }
  }
    return arr
}

var aa = [1,2,2,4,3,3,2,4,6];
console.log(uniq(aa));

6.双循坏 (效率低)

function uniq(arr){
    for(var j=0;j<arr.length;j++)
  for(var i= j+1;i <arr.length;i++){
      if(arr[j]==arr[i]){
          arr.splice(j,1);
          i--;
          j--;
      }
  }
    return arr
}
